WebNov 10, 2014 · The greenhouse effect is well-established. Increased concentrations of greenhouse gases, such as CO 2, reduce the amount of outgoing longwave radiation (OLR) to space; thus, energy accumulates in the climate system, and the planet warms. WebThe Earth emits infrared radiation or longwave radiation. This follows directly from the electromagnetic energy spectrum and the respective temperatures of the Sun and Earth. The Sun emits radiation at a shorter wavelength than the Earth because it has a higher temperature, and Planck’s curve for higher temperatures peaks at shorter wavelengths.
